Masses of soft pink flower spikes sway gracefully above the foliage from late summer into autumn, drawing bees and other pollinators in numbers. Commonly known as Bistort, ‘Elworthy Candy’ has lance-shaped, deep green leaves that clasp the stems — a characteristic reflected in the species name amplexicaulis.
The species is native to the Himalayas; ‘Elworthy Candy’ is a selected cultivar valued for its soft candy-pink flower colour. It thrives in sun or partial shade with moisture-retentive soil, tolerating wet conditions well — ideal for planting along streams, around pond edges or in boggy situations, where it has room to spread. The stems also make excellent cut flowers. 100% peat-free.
Synonym: Persicaria amplexicaulis ‘Elworthy Candy’
Height × Spread: 120cm × 70cm
